BILLY H. BOWLING MEMORIAL GOLF TOURNAMENT

For 17 years, First Metro Bank has hosted the annual Billy H. Bowling Memorial Golf Tournament in honor of the bank’s first President, Billy Bowling. The proceeds from each tournament fund the Billy Bowling Memorial Scholarship at Northwest Shoals Community College. This year’s tournament raised over $9,000.00 for area students!

W.C. HANDY FESTIVAL—“SAX IN THE CITY”

Each year First Metro Bank kicks off the W.C. Handy Festival with our “Sax in the City” event featuring The Midnighters at Wilson Park in Florence. Every year, thousands of fans pack the park for this free event. The Midnighters never disappoint, entertaining late into the night.

We sell our famous “Sax in the City” t-shirts for $5.00 each. It seems no matter how many shirts we order, we never have enough. This year, we sold 1850 shirts! If you didn’t get a shirt this year, next year we encourage you to visit any First Metro location any time during the month prior to the event to ensure that you receive one. All proceeds on shirt sales are donated to the W.C. Handy Festival.

SUMMERSTOCK AT THE RITZ—West Side Story

First Metro Bank is proud to be a Founding Sponsor of the SummerStock at the Ritz. First Metro teamed up with the Tennessee Valley Art Association and accomplished director David Hope to fund and organize this invaluable cultural training program.

Over the past several years, local school systems and colleges have gradually lost their theatre arts programs due to budget cuts. SummerStock at the Ritz offers students of all ages an opportunity to train with theatre arts professionals during the summer months. At the end of each summer, these students present quality live theatre productions of popular Broadway performances.

The inaugural production was West Side Story. The five performance dates sold out so quickly that encore performances were added so that the entire community could come together to appreciate the hard work and talent of the area’s youth. Two First Metro Bank employees performed in West Side Story—one in the orchestra and the other as a leading actor. We are so proud of the hard work and achievement of all the performers.

SWAMPERS RACE

The Muscle Shoals Civitan’s organize the Annual Swampers Race to raise money for various local charitable organizations. First Metro Bank consistently supports this event as a monetary donator and our employees are devoted participants in the race. Each year, First Metro places in the Company Awards for most participation. Two First Metro Bank employees are active members of the Muscle Shoals Civitans, Delores Cotton and Huston Kennedy.
